Alamos Gold Inc. Alamos is a Canadian-based intermediate gold producer with diversified production from three operations in North America. This includes the Island Gold District and Young-Davidson mine in northern Ontario, Canada, and the Mulatos District in Sonora State, Mexico. Additionally, the Company has a strong portfolio of growth projects including the IGD Expansion, and the Lynn Lake project in Manitoba, Canada. Alamos employs more than 2,400 people and is committed to the highest standards of sustainable development. The Company’s shares are traded on the TSX and NYSE under the symbol AGI. IT Support Analyst Reporting to the IT Service Delivery Manager, the IT Support Analyst is responsible for delivering exceptional technical support to employees across the organization. This role serves as the primary point of contact for IT support while also supporting device management, software deployment, user onboarding, and endpoint administration. Primary Responsibilities: * Provide first and second-level support via phone, email, Teams, walk-ups, and the IT service portal * Troubleshoot and resolve hardware, software, mobile device, Microsoft 365, and connectivity issues * Configure, deploy, and support laptops, mobile devices, peripherals, and collaboration tools * Manage employee onboarding and offboarding activities, including account creation, device setup and technology orientation * Support endpoint management through Microsoft Intune, including device enrollment compliance, and application deployments * Deploy software and updates using automated deployment tools such as Intune and PDQ * Maintain detailed IT asset inventory and equipment records * Document incidents, requests, procedures, and solutions within the ITSM platform * Contribute to IT projects, process improvements, and technology rollouts What You Bring! * 4+ years of experience in IT support, service desk, or desktop support roles * Strong knowledge of Windows 11 and Microsoft 365 * Experience with employee onboarding, device deployment, and account provisioning * Experience supporting mobile devices and endpoint management solutions * Solid experience with Microsoft Intune, ServiceNow, and software deployment tools such as PDQ is required * Excellent troubleshooting, communication, and customer service skills * Ability to man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ced environment * Exceptional documentation and record-keeping skills * Proficient in demonstrating analytical and problem-solving skills * Working knowledge of networks and network cabling preferred Target Salary Range: CAD $70,000 - $90,000 The expected salary range for this role is intended to support transparency and informed decision making. Final compensation will be based on skills, experience and internal equity.
